Corozal is a small place in Panama. It is a type of area called a corregimiento. Corozal is located in the Las Palmas District, which is part of the Veraguas Province.

What is Corozal?

Corozal is a corregimiento. Think of a corregimiento like a small local area or a neighborhood within a larger district. It is a way that Panama organizes its land and people.

Where is Corozal located?

Corozal is found in the western part of Panama. It is in the Veraguas Province, which is one of the ten provinces of Panama. Within Veraguas, Corozal belongs to the Las Palmas District.

How many people live in Corozal?

The number of people living in Corozal has changed over the years.

  • In 1990, about 1,072 people lived there.
  • By 2000, the population was around 1,034 people.
  • The most recent count from 2010 showed that 920 people lived in Corozal.

This means that the population of Corozal has become a little smaller over these years.
